About me
My name is Allison Eddy. I am a wife and mother of 4 kids, 2 boys and 2 girls. One of my daughter's has Down Syndrome and two of my kids struggle with dyslexia and ADHD. We have experienced many hardships, as my daughter with DS has almost died on us 3 different times. My faith in God has pulled me though and made me a more compassionate person and therapist.
I have a Bachelor degree in Science and a Master in Arts from Oral Roberts University. I have been a Licensed Professional Counselor in Oklahoma for 16 years. I have experience with many different populations and treatment approaches. I specialize in Depression, anxiety, ADHD and have been trained in suicide prevention. I have been trained in CBT, C-Sara suicide prevention and other treatment solutions. I have worked with people who have suffered trauma, neglect and abuse. Along with other treatments, I have also been trained in a forgiveness program that helps individuals learn to forgive those who have hurt them. I believe everyone is the expert of their own life and I am here to facilitate whatever change they would like to see in their lives.
